The Nike Air Zoom Elite Commercial Gets on the Fast Track

The Nike Air Zoom Elite 8 is a running shoe built for speed, so it only makes sense that the advertising campaign is equally as fast.

Created by advertising agency Must Be Something and directed by Neal Brennan (of the Chapelle Show fame), the 'Find Your Fast' commercial is a 60-second spot that features 13 elite athletes living life in the fast lane. The campaign is accompanied by a larger challenge, issued by Nike to the running community, to log in their fastest mileage before August 30th (using the Nike+ Community app).

If viewers learn anything from watching the Nike Air Zoom Elite 8, it's that there are different types of speed, and all you need to do is, well, "Find Your Fast."
